What are Online Physics Calculators?

Online physics calculators are web-based applications or tools that help users perform physics-related calculations, resolve equations, and envision complicated principles. They can cover a wide variety of subjects, including mechanics, thermodynamics, electromagnetism, optics, and quantum physics.

Limitations of Online Physics Calculators

While online physics calculators offer many advantages, they likewise have some limitations that users should understand:

  1. Dependency: Relying too heavily on calculators can prevent the development of basic algebra and analytical skills.
  2. Internet Access Required: Users require a stable internet connection to utilize these tools.
  3. Minimal Contextual Learning: Some calculators may not provide an in-depth description of the concepts behind the estimations, which can stall thorough learning.
